"Rea Estates are delighted to offer to the sales market this immaculately presented 4 Bedroom Detached property.
Situated in a quiet cul-de-sac on this popular residential development the property benefits from having Gas Central Heating and Upvc Double Glazing throughout and with the addition of a Conservatory to the rear providing extra living space.
The accommodation briefly comprises of: Entrance Hallway with Ground Floor Cloakroom/WC, Kitchen, Lounge/ Dining Room with patio doors to the rear garden and Conservatory.
To the first floor there are 4 Bedrooms, the master of which has en suite facilities and a pristine Family Bathroom.
Occupying a generous plot, the property has an open plan garden to the front, which is laid to lawn. A double width driveway, providing added off road parking, leads to an attached garage up and over door, power and lighting.
To the rear there is an enclosed landscaped garden, which again is laid to lawn with flower borders. A gravelled patio area provides an ideal spot for outside dining and entertaining.
